Pukyong National University Holds '2023 Fisheries Industry Expert Course Completion Ceremony'

On the afternoon of the 16th, Pukyong National University held the '2023 Fisheries Industry Expert Course Completion Ceremony' at the Busan West District Advanced Seafood Processing Complex.


The Fisheries Industry Expert Course is a program designed to transfer advanced fisheries technology and trends to local seafood processing business owners and workers to secure the competitiveness of Busan's fisheries industry.


Since its establishment in 2012 by the Pukyong National University Seafood Processing Research Center under the commission of the Ministry of Oceans and Fisheries and Busan City, the program has produced a total of about 360 fisheries professionals, including 34 this year.


The event was attended by Jeon Byung-su, Director of the Pukyong National University Seafood Processing Research Center, Lee Guk-jin, Head of the Fisheries Promotion Division of Busan City, representatives of the graduating class, and the graduates.


At the ceremony, 34 members of the 12th class received certificates of completion; Shin Jung-hyun, CEO of Shinna Food, received the Minister of Oceans and Fisheries Award; Lim Chang-gyu, Deputy General Manager of Cheong-a Trading, received the Busan Mayor's Award; Kang Hyun-woo, CEO of Daebang Fisheries, received the Pukyong National University President's Award; and Jeong Geun-young, CEO of Offi, along with six others, received the Seafood Processing Research Center Director's Award.

This year, in response to the rapidly changing future fisheries industry, 100 hours of education were conducted based on trends in the seafood food industry, including theoretical and field training on the latest technological trends.


The training covered topics such as the marine discharge of treated water from the Fukushima nuclear power plant and response measures, HMR market response strategies and seafood food packaging technology, applications of artificial intelligence technology in the fisheries industry, cases of building smart seafood processing factories, seafood tech, and digital marketing of seafood products.


Jeon Byung-su, Director of the Seafood Processing Research Center, stated, “The curriculum was designed to help trainees of the Fisheries Industry Expert Course respond to the rapidly changing fisheries industry and international situation after COVID-19.”


He added, “We will continue to strive to shift the mindset of Busan’s seafood processing industry, which relies on know-how, and to nurture fisheries experts who can lead the future fisheries industry.”


Pukyong National University plans to reflect the results of satisfaction surveys and lecture evaluations from the graduates in the 2024 education program.
